Digest: The Act tells OHCS to start a pilot program to help pregnant people and their families get stable housing. (Flesch Readability Score: 67.3). Directs the Housing and Community Services Department to establish a pilot program to assist pregnant persons and their immediate family members in attaining stable housing. Sunsets on January 2, 2028. A BILL FOR AN ACT Relating to affordable housing. Be It Enacted by the People of the State of Oregon: SECTION 1. (1) The Housing and Community Services Department shall establish a pilot program to assist pregnant persons and their immediate family members who are members of a low income household to attain stable housing that begins as early as the person con- ceives and continues at least until the child is at least two years of age. The housing must be safe, affordable, accessible, sized to meet the needs of the family and located in proximity to the places of employment and education of all members of the family and to the health care, child care and commercial services, and other community assets, beneficial to the well-being of all members of the family. The housing must be subject to an affordable housing covenant as described in ORS 456.270 to 456.295 that maintains the housing as affordable to low income households for a period of at least 10 years. (2) In order to carry out the pilot program established under this section, the depart- ment: (a) Shall allow an owner of a rental housing project development financed by the de- partment to set aside housing units for participants in the pilot program; and (b) May accept, from any organization or state or local government agency that offers rental assistance, gifts, grants or other contributions of any portion of that rental assist- ance. (3) The department shall modify any existing scoring criteria for rental housing project development applicants in order to give priority to applicants that commit to setting aside housing units for participants in the pilot program established under this section. (4) The department may adopt rules to carry out this section including rules to determine pilot program participant eligibility. SECTION 2. Section 1 of this 2025 Act is repealed on January 2, 2028.
